See In Yonder Manger Lo'
See, amid the winter's snow,
Born for us on earth below,
See, the tender Lamb appears,
Promised from eternal years.

Hail, thou ever blessed morn;
Hail, Redemption's happy dawn;
Sing all through Jerusalem,
"Christ is born in Bethlehem!"

Lo! within a manger lies
He who built the starry skies.
He who, throned in height sublime,
Sits amid the Cherubim.

Say, ye holy shepherds, say:
What your joyful news today?
Wherefore have ye left your sheep
On the lonely mountain steep?

"As we watched at dead of night,
Lo! we saw a wondrous light;
Angels, singing 'Peace on earth',
Told us of the Savior's birth."

Sacred Infant, all divine,
What a tender love was thine
Thus to come from highest bliss
Down to such a world as this.

Teach, O teach us, holy Child,
By thy face so meek and mild,
Teach us to resemble thee
In thy sweet humility.
